我看到很多公司提供 exe 包装器,但是 pdf 方面的安全性是否以编程方式提供?
问问题
190 次
2 回答
1
最简洁的答案是不。当您给某人密文、密钥和密码时,他们将始终能够重现明文。正是由于这个原因,DRM 普遍失败。
长答案是,您有时可以尝试一些花哨的技巧来防止在某些情况下复制,如果您的听众不尝试破坏它,这可能“有效”,但在一般情况下不会。您不能真正称“只要没有人试图破坏它就安全”的东西是安全的。
PDF 格式本身有一个“所有者密码”,允许作者禁止读者打印、修改文档等……当然,实际上没有任何机制可以阻止任何人这样做。如果您试图阻止营销部门的人打印它或其他东西,那么也许。但是,如果您将其发布到 Internet 上,只需假设它可以并且将被复制,但用户认为合适。
于 2011-03-09T21:19:05.810 回答
1
好吧,您可以加密 PDF。您还可以使用自定义加密处理程序,从而使您的文件无法使用股票 Acrobat 或 Reader 读取(需要将您的解密插件安装到 Acrobat 或 Reader 以使他们了解您的加密)。问题是 acrobat 的 DRM SDK(允许您创建加密插件的那个)曾经有巨大的成本(比如 25,000 美元开始)。不过,我不知道是否仍然如此。
另一个不那么糟糕的选项是将所有内容渲染到图形上 - 这使得文本复制变得更加困难(尽管可以打印所有内容并将其 OCR 还原)。
于 2011-03-09T15:02:38.313 回答